Why This Role Exists

Zanes Law Injury Lawyers is a 23-year, founder led premier firm operating across two markets in Arizona and scaling. The firm has grown organically entirely under two founders who are each still personally involved in all aspects of the firm. This role is a new role and exists to give the firm a true second-in-command to the founders, not a coordinator, not an office manager, someone who holds real authority over Operations, Finance, and People, so the founders can focus running the firm at a strategic level.

This role in office in our flagship office at 3333 E. Camelback Rd, in beautiful Phoenix, AZ.

What You'll OwnFirm Operations & Authority

Full ownership of day-to-day business operations across Intake, Settlements, Finance and People & Infrastructure. Direct management of the Intake Manager, Settlements Manager, Accounting Lead, and HR Manager, the firm's first layer of true departmental leadership. Independent authority to negotiate vendor, technology, and facilities contracts within board-approved budget. Decision-making authority on operational matters, with accountability for outcomes, not just activity.

Financial Stewardship

Own the operating budget and report on performance against it. Partner with the Settlement Department on cash flow, settlement timing, and case-cost visibility. Bring financial discipline to every operational decision: vendor terms, staffing ratios, technology spend.

People & Talent Leadership

Along with department managers, owns the full hiring lifecycle for staff and support roles: sourcing, screening, offers, and a structured onboarding program. Serve as the point of authority on HR policy, performance management, compensation administration, and employee relations. Build a firm-wide reporting cadence so headcount, ramp time, and retention are always visible.

Strategic Partnership to the Founders

Serve as second-in-command to the founders, sitting as an operating peer and being accepted as such by attorneys and department leadership. Build and maintain the firmโ€™s KPI dashboards from intake volume, case velocity, settlement throughput, cost per case, case aging, collections and knows where things stand always. Take ownership of cross-functional initiatives (systems rollouts, process redesign, expansion) from decision through completion, including chasing down blockers before they become delays. Advise the founders on organizational and operational decisions and act as a sounding board on strategy. Support marketing and business development infrastructure.

What We're Looking For
  • 10+ years in a COO, Executive Director, or senior operations leadership role; law firm or professional services experience strongly preferred.
  • Experience leading people and processes in a nine figure organization (non-corporate).
  • Demonstrated experience owning a budget and an HR function independently, with real decision-making authority, not in a support or coordinator capacity.
  • A track record of being accepted as a peer by professionals (attorneys, physicians, partners) in a professional services environment.
  • Comfortable building reporting systems and KPI dashboards personally when needed (Excel/Sheets fluency required;), while also delegating that work as the team matures.
  • Masters, MBA, CPA, or equivalent credential a strong plus.
  • Self-directed; turns ambiguous priorities into a concrete operating plan without needing one handed to them.
Compensation
  • Base salary: $200,000โ€“$250,000, commensurate with experience and professional services background, plus a performance bonus tied to firm-wide KPIs, budget performance, and hiring/operational outcomes
  • 401K, two profit sharing plans
  • Health insurance 95% company paid
  • Vision, Dental, Life, STD, LTD
